7-Day Adventure Itinerary in Ladakh

Viewed by 51 travelers
Wednesday, November 8: Arrival in Leh

Start your adventure in Leh, the capital of Ladakh. In the morning, explore the Leh Palace, a nine-storey royal residence that offers panoramic views of the city. In the afternoon, visit Shanti Stupa, a beautiful white-domed Buddhist stupa perched on a hilltop. As the evening approaches, take a leisurely stroll through the bustling Leh Market, where you can shop for souvenirs and local handicrafts.

  • Leh Palace: Entrance fee approx. 200 INR, 1-2 hours
  • Shanti Stupa: Free entry, 1-2 hours
  • Leh Market: Variable expenses, 1-2 hours
Thursday, November 9: Nubra Valley

Embark on an exciting journey to Nubra Valley. In the morning, drive through the scenic Khardung La, one of the highest motorable passes in the world, to reach Nubra Valley. Enjoy the afternoon exploring the sand dunes of Hunder and riding a double-humped Bactrian camel. As the evening sets in, visit the Diskit Monastery, known for its mesmerizing views and ancient Buddhist artifacts.

  • Drive to Nubra Valley: Approx. 5-6 hours
  • Hunder Sand Dunes: Camel ride approx. 300 INR, 2-3 hours
  • Diskit Monastery: Free entry, 1-2 hours

Friday, November 10: Pangong Lake

Experience the awe-inspiring beauty of Pangong Lake. Start your day early and embark on a thrilling drive through Chang La, the third highest motorable pass in Ladakh. Spend the afternoon mesmerized by the crystal-clear blue waters of Pangong Lake and enjoy a picnic by the lakeside. As the evening approaches, witness the enchanting colors of the sunset reflecting on the lake.

  • Drive to Pangong Lake: Approx. 5-6 hours
  • Pangong Lake visit: Free entry, picnic expenses variable, 4-5 hours
Saturday, November 11: Indus Valley Tour

Explore the historical and cultural sites of the Indus Valley. Start your day by visiting the famous monasteries of Thiksey and Hemis. In the afternoon, discover the ancient rock carvings at the mysterious Magnetic Hill and explore the confluence of the Indus and Zanskar rivers at Nimoo. As the evening sets in, return to Leh and explore the local food scene.

  • Thiksey Monastery: Entrance fee approx. 30 INR, 1-2 hours
  • Hemis Monastery: Entrance fee approx. 50 INR, 1-2 hours
  • Magnetic Hill: Free entry, 1-2 hours
  • Nimoo: Free entry, 1-2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For adventure enthusiasts, Ladakh offers numerous off the beaten path attractions. Explore the stunning beauty of Zanskar Valley through multi-day treks like the Chadar Trek, where you can walk on the frozen Zanskar River. Leh also serves as a base for mountaineering expeditions in the surrounding Himalayan peaks. Local favorites include visiting the Alchi Monastery, known for its ancient frescoes, and experiencing the exhilaration of mountain biking on the challenging trails of Ladakh.
